Output 40343c4ba6969a9e8a80c78a97c0a111ebb2193d70c5d18c1fe34b92484c831f:4

value
4250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b59803cea7f2ed48c4217960b4d1f13d20ee5d2 OP_EQUAL
address
376q1VgcV899NSFxdEjyuspqu1aco6L7SN
transaction
40343c4ba6969a9e8a80c78a97c0a111ebb2193d70c5d18c1fe34b92484c831f
spent
true